Easy Peach Dumplings

Ideal as an extravagant brunch and also perfect for dessert, this easy peach dumplings recipe is well worth making. They’re simple to prepare and cook, and literally heaven when paired with vanilla ice cream.
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 35 minutes
Servings 8

Ingredients
  

  • C. Granulated sugar
  • 2 Cans of peaches drained well 15 0z. each
  • C. Brown sugar
  • 2 Cans of refrigerated crescent rolls
  • 1 ½ C. Sprite
  • 3 tsp. Cinnamon
  • 1 C. Butter
  • Vanilla ice cream for serving

Instructions
 

  • Heat the oven to 350 degrees.
  • Roll the dough out onto a counter, and separate into triangles.
  • Place two slices of peaches inside each of the dough triangles where they are the thickest.
  • Sprinkle with a little cinnamon, and roll closed.
  • Place the dumplings into a well greased 9x13 baking dish.
  • Add the butter to a skillet over medium heat on the stove.
  • Stir in the brown sugar, granulated sugar and any remaining cinnamon. Stir until the sugar has melted.
  • Pour the mixture into the baking dish over the dumplings.
  • Add the Sprite into the baking dish, but pour around the edges, and not over top of the dumplings.
  • Bake for 30-35 minutes until browned.
  • Let cool for 10 minutes before serving with vanilla ice cream.
